Today is my best friends 30th birthday, and that blows me away a little. We met in the first year of junior school when we were 7. I called her a scruff, she called me stuck up, and that was a start of a friendship that's lated since then. We went through teens and now twenties together. Had terrible fights but also laughed together so much. We're totally different people, always have been. We've never had the same tastes in anything and she doesn't understand fandom at all. But though she laughs, it's never in a mean way. She supports me writing even though she got embarrassed when she read what I wrote, and it was only a kissing scene *g* I just love her to bits, when I think of her now I think of that kid who glared then shared her sweets. How we walked miles as we hung at the local hang out eying boys. How her family was mine, a refuge when things got too much. How we drank Pink Kangaroos, (larger,cider,vodka and blackcurrant in a pint glass) at the clubs, dancing way into the night. How she was there when I met James and there when Corey was in special care after he was born, telling me to be strong as doctor after doctor told me he could die. We don't see each other as often now, but I just want to wish Jill happy birthday, she'll never see this but I'm sending loads of love to her now, and in person when I see her later.
